Telangana: BJP to develop tribal hamlets if it wins next polls, says Bandi Sanjay Kumar

HYDERABAD: BJP state chief Bandi Sanjay Kumar on Sunday claimed that if the party wins the next assembly elections, it will embark on a mission to develop all tribal hamlets.

“Prime Minister Narendra Modi saw that toilets were constructed in tribal hamlets,” he told a gathering during the Banjara festival organized in the city. “Only the BJP has a special regard for tribals, while the TRS government completely ignored them,” he added.

Asking the chief minister K Chandrasekhar Rao about the number of double-bedroom houses erected in tribal areas, Sanjay said, “CM is unconcerned about their issues, even the suicides of unemployed youth are not important to him.” Speaking on the occasion, BJP MLA Eatala Rajender alleged that Chief Minister KCR lied about development promises made to tribals in the state.
